Function of male structures in flower
[Stamen]
Anther: Pollen production
Filament: Stalk containing anther
Function of female structures in flower
[Carpel]
Stigma: Sricky top, receptive surface for pollen
Style: Stalk of Carpel
Ovary: Contains ovule. Matured to become fruit
Sepal: Leaf like structure. Protects flower bed
Functions of all organs
Roots: Absorb H2O. Anchor plant
Stem: Support leaves + flowers. Transport H2O + sugar. Store food
Leaves: Photosynthesis
Flowers: Reproductive organs. Produce seeds
